I am freezing them as soup base, as well as simply heating up the puree. I fried up a large pan of bacon for seasoning the squash and bean dishes as well.  I added a few spoonfuls of bacon and drippings, a dash of canola oil, seasonings and a cup of water to each batch of squash, and cooked them at several times, with the same measured amounts of water (1 cup per batch) and 10 cups or so of cubed squash. 11 minutes was a smooth puree with just stirring with a spoon. 10 minutes was a chunky puree, and 9 was soft chunks. The soil is laden with volcanic dust, and a little water and mulch and you can grow many things here. I have been drying piles of veggies from my garden. I have lots of squash this years, some of which are my own hybrid plants. I remove the seedy pulp, cut in strips or rounds, blanch for three minutes, and dry in my dehydrator. This year the dried squash is sweet, like apples! Like I tell my husband, squash is like the tofu of the veggie world, and you can add it to most anything. These salt preserved lemons are incredibly versatile, and I add additional zest and thin peels as well as the lemons themselves, which I cut into fairly small pieces. One little chunk will flavor an entire chicken, rubbed on the bird. Just the smell when you open the jar makes my mouth water! It would be outrageous rubbed around the rim of a marguerita glass, or a glass of tomato juice, mmm,mmm! I tried it for the first time in a pot of blackeyed peas, and it was amazing. I also adore split pea soup, and it adds a brilliance and polished flavor to the peas. Just a little dab will do. He is a big bird lover, (I got it from him) so I gave him a piece of art I made called &amp;quot;bluebird in summer&amp;quot;, it is a mixed media wall hanging with a lot of freemotion sewing involved. It came out well, and I used a lot of different techniques to make it, such as the discharge dying technique I used on the mountains. I used silk, bleach, and vinegar,( the vinegar neutralizes the bleach at the end of the process). My white silk ribbons arrived yesterday!
